Output 3e3b8e749f6e9d6ba0d4b65c4018c7cf687285bcf500a8320c6120cbd26a342f:1

value
16805324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d84a6f5e3b9d70d23673a17831e7b580c1919c97 OP_EQUAL
address
3MQf3pGaAXNtjLqBDXs3soYbgETerMMiBV
transaction
3e3b8e749f6e9d6ba0d4b65c4018c7cf687285bcf500a8320c6120cbd26a342f
confirmations
427037
spent
true